Understanding the Core Concepts of Ford Audio Wiring
Before you start stripping wires, you must understand how Ford engineered the audio system in the late nineties. The 1998 Ranger typically utilizes a standardized 16-pin connector. This plug handles everything from the constant 12V power to the individual speaker polarities.
Core concepts in automotive wiring involve distinguishing between constant power and switched power. Constant power keeps your radio’s clock and presets alive when the truck is off. Switched power, or accessory power, tells the radio to turn on only when you turn the ignition key.
A common mistake is assuming all black wires are grounds. In some Ford models, ground wires might have a small stripe, or the ground may be achieved through the radio chassis itself. Always verify your ground connection to prevent “alternator whine” or buzzing in your speakers.
Mastering the 1998 ford ranger radio wiring diagram
The following list provides the exact color codes for the 1998 ford ranger radio wiring diagram. Use this list to match your aftermarket radio’s harness to the factory wires. Always double-check these colors with a multimeter before making permanent connections.
Power and Signal Wire Colors
- Constant 12V+ Power: Light Green/Violet
- Switched Accessory 12V+ Power: Yellow/Black
- Ground Wire: Black/Light Green
- Illumination/Dimmer: Light Blue/Red
- Power Antenna Trigger: Blue (if equipped)
Speaker Wire Colors and Polarities
- Left Front Speaker (+): Orange/Light Green
- Left Front Speaker (-): Light Blue/White
- Right Front Speaker (+): White/Light Green
- Right Front Speaker (-): Dark Green/Orange
- Left Rear Speaker (+): Pink/Light Green
- Left Rear Speaker (-): Dark Blue/Orange
- Right Rear Speaker (+): Pink/Light Blue
- Right Rear Speaker (-): Light Green/Orange
Identifying these wires correctly ensures that your speakers move in phase. If you swap the positive and negative on one speaker, the bass response will sound thin and hollow. Proper polarity is essential for a rich, full-bodied sound in the small cabin of a Ranger.
Essential Tools for a Professional Installation
To execute a clean install based on the 1998 ford ranger radio wiring diagram, you need more than just a pair of scissors. Professional technicians use specific tools to ensure connections last for the life of the vehicle. Vibration and heat in a truck can easily loosen poor connections.
A high-quality digital multimeter is your most important tool. It allows you to verify that the Light Green/Violet wire actually has 12 volts when the truck is off. Never use a test light on modern vehicle circuits, as they can sometimes trigger sensitive electronics.
For connecting the wires, we recommend using butt connectors with a proper crimping tool or soldering the joints. If you choose to solder, always use heat-shrink tubing to insulate the connection. Avoid using electrical tape alone, as it tends to unravel and leave a sticky mess over time.
You will also need a set of Ford DIN removal tools. These are U-shaped metal keys that insert into the holes on the face of the factory radio. They release the internal clips, allowing the unit to slide out of the dashboard without cracking the plastic trim.
Step-by-Step Implementation Guide
Begin by disconnecting the negative battery terminal. This is a non-negotiable safety step that prevents short circuits while you are working behind the dash. A short circuit can blow the “Radio” or “Dome Light” fuse, or worse, damage the GEM module.
Insert the DIN tools into the four holes on the factory radio face. Push them in until you feel a click, then pull the tools outward while pulling the radio toward you. Once the radio is out, unplug the antenna cable and the rectangular wiring harness from the rear.
We strongly suggest using an aftermarket wiring adapter. This allows you to wire your new radio to the adapter on your workbench. You then simply plug the adapter into the factory Ford plug, keeping the original 1998 ford ranger radio wiring diagram intact and uncut.
Match the colors from your new radio’s manual to the adapter’s wires. Most aftermarket brands (like Pioneer or Sony) use a standard color code that differs from Ford’s. For example, the aftermarket Yellow wire usually connects to Ford’s Light Green/Violet wire.
Once your harness is prepped, plug it into the truck and the new radio. Reconnect the battery temporarily to test the unit. Check the FM/AM reception, Bluetooth functionality, and ensure each speaker is firing correctly before snapping the dash back together.
Common Pitfalls and How to Avoid Them
One of the most frequent issues is the “No Power” scenario. If your new radio won’t turn on, check the fuse box located on the driver’s side end of the dashboard. Fuses 20 and 29 are common culprits for audio-related power loss in the 1998 Ranger.
Another pitfall is the parasitic draw. If you accidentally swap the constant and switched power wires, your radio will stay on even when the key is removed. This will drain your battery overnight, leaving you stranded in the driveway or at a remote campsite.
Be careful with the Illumination wire. Some aftermarket radios do not require this connection. If you connect the Ford Light Blue/Red wire to a ground by mistake, you will blow the fuse for your entire instrument cluster, leaving your gauges dark at night.
If you experience a loud “pop” when turning the truck on or off, you may have a grounding issue. Ensure the Black/Light Green wire is securely connected to a clean, unpainted metal surface or the corresponding wire in the harness. A weak ground is the leading cause of audio distortion.
Cost-Benefit Analysis: DIY vs. Professional Shop
Performing this installation yourself can save you a significant amount of money. Most car audio shops charge between $75 and $150 for a basic head unit installation. By using the 1998 ford ranger radio wiring diagram, you can complete the job for the cost of a $15 harness adapter.
The benefit of DIY goes beyond just the cash savings. You gain a deep understanding of your truck’s electrical layout. This knowledge is invaluable if you ever need to troubleshoot a dead speaker or add off-road lights and amplifiers later on.
However, if your truck has a complex premium sound system with a factory amplifier, the wiring becomes more difficult. In these rare cases, a professional might be worth the cost to avoid bypassing the amp incorrectly. For the standard 1998 Ranger, the DIY route is highly recommended.

Frequently Asked Questions About 1998 ford ranger radio wiring diagram
What color is the constant power wire in a 1998 Ford Ranger?
The constant 12V power wire is Light Green/Violet. This wire provides power at all times, even when the ignition is off, to maintain your radio’s memory settings and clock.
Can I use the 1998 wiring diagram for a 1999 or 2000 model?
Yes, Ford used the same wiring colors for the Ranger audio system from 1998 through 2003 in most configurations. However, always verify the colors with a multimeter to account for mid-year production changes.
Why are there two different black wires in my dash?
Usually, the Black/Light Green wire is the main ground. The other black wire might be a shield for the antenna or a secondary ground for the factory amplifier. Always use the Black/Light Green wire for your main radio ground.
What should I do if my factory wire colors don’t match the diagram?
If your colors are different, your truck might have a Premium Sound package or a previous owner may have altered the wiring. Use a multimeter to find your 12V constant and 12V switched wires manually before connecting anything.
Do I need a dash kit for a 1998 Ford Ranger?
Yes, if you are installing a standard single-DIN or double-DIN radio, you will need a dash kit. This kit fills the gaps around the new radio and provides a secure mounting bracket to hold the unit in place.
